Transaction abccb20eae2e45900458ed38b950365ffc83085634ae38564f8c1d633d795389
1 Input
2 Outputs
- abccb20eae2e45900458ed38b950365ffc83085634ae38564f8c1d633d795389:0
- abccb20eae2e45900458ed38b950365ffc83085634ae38564f8c1d633d795389:1
value 9894381
address 13kVoCm3z3gBFXFoq2ho8aB8dehdLukHJT
value 1467012888
address 1KeyjoNdFfF2MGqL8UHsyLuKuQXjxZ83ZP